I did this series of drawings during the COVID 19 pandemic. "It’s time to reimagine New York City’s neighborhoods."

What if we could walk across the building, from one street to another? There are fewer cars on the streets. We blend indoor and outdoor spaces. Daily life has become more fluid, with our workplace and living space more integrated. We work from home alone, collaborate with colleagues in the office, cook and share food, and find personal time away from the family at the office. We can also invite colleagues to our home garden.

There are many empty storefronts, some covered with plywood, and the streets are not well maintained, inviting messiness. What else could these spaces be used for?
